Human-Centric Design and Service Engineering: integrating technology, ethics and creativity

2022-12-02

Abstract excerpt

In this article we consider the implications and effects of the evolution of technology in the design process and its consequences, we explore different points of view on how to use or integrate technology in the design process, as well as how to adapt to the design cycle. of software development, new methodologies specific to designers and that have emerged as a result of the paradigm shift from product to servic...
